So i'm looking at January 6, 2013. I currently have OZ F LAX-ICN 12/25 on the outbound and inbound UA F NRT-SEA already booked using US Airways Miles.

I wasn't able to find any other way back to the west coast as my travel dates are firm. But I saw that NH has NRT-SEA in C, which might be 787 by the time Jan 6th hits. So my question is, would it be worthwhile to take that and give up the 30K extra miles?

This will probably be my last Intl trip for a few years so I wanted to go F to get the best experience and I was worried I would end up wasting it on an old UA 777.

Any help or suggestions would be appreciated! thanks!

You are assuming NH will open up award space on that route, but I have *read* many people rave about NH service in the premium cabin. Service-wise, I don't think you will take too much of a hit (unless you run into a superb crew on UA). Not sure how the hard products would compare though: F on UA777 vs. C on NH787 (assuming the 787 is delivered by then).

I'd take NH 787 C, assuming you can find the inventory. The UA F product just isn't that special to be worth the extra points IMO.

You will have a hard time finding availability on NH because of the New Year holidays.

NH may still be flying the 777 then.

F is not that much more expensive in points. I would fly F in UA.

You can usually book flights in Saver F close in on that route.
